Flowers Foods Stock Performance
Flowers Foods (NYSE:FLO – Get Free Report) last issued its earnings results on Thursday, August 20th. The company reported $0.21 earnings per share for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$0.22 by ($0.01). The firm had revenue of $1.19 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$1.23 billion. Flowers Foods had a return on equity of 14.91% and a net margin of 1.06%.Flowers Foods’s quarterly revenue was down 4.0%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ter in the prior year, the company posted $0.28 earnings per share. Flowers Foods has set its FY 2026 guidance at 0.750-0.850 EPS. As a group, sell-side analysts anticipate that Flowers Foods, Inc. will post 0.79 EPS for the current fiscal year.
Flowers Foods Announces Dividend
The firm also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Friday, September 25th. Stockholders of record on Friday, September 11th will be given a $0.125 dividend. This represents a $0.50 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 7.8%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Friday, September 11th. Flowers Foods’s dividend payout ratio is presently 192.31%.

Flowers Foods Company Profile
Flowers Foods, Inc is one of the largest producers of packaged bakery foods in the United States, offering a variety of fresh bread, buns, rolls, snack cakes and tortillas. Headquartered in Thomasville, Georgia, the company operates an extensive network of bakeries and distribution centers that serve retail grocery chains, convenience stores, mass merchandisers and foodservice customers nationwide.
